Top Software Engineer Jobs in NYC, NY
The Senior Software Engineer will focus on evolving and maintaining the backend infrastructure at re:collect, designing new product features, and ensuring system performance and stability. This role involves building APIs, mentoring, and improving the overall codebase while working in a collaborative and dynamic start-up environment.
As a Lead Software Engineer in Workflow Automations at Personio, you will design and implement complex software solutions, collaborate with cross-functional teams, mentor junior engineers, and drive technical excellence within the team. You will also resolve technical issues and foster a culture of continuous improvement and innovation.
As a Staff Software Engineer, you will develop scalable and reliable backend systems, ensuring application performance and contributing to code reviews. You will evaluate new technologies, work on tech debt backlogs, and implement automated testing for services while collaborating with a team to enhance user experience.
As a Lead Software Engineer at Personio, you'll drive and own complex projects while ensuring high technical standards. You'll mentor team members, promote best practices, and communicate with stakeholders to enhance product delivery, focusing on operational excellence and strategic input.
The Staff Software Engineer will lead the development of Cedar's staff-facing software and tools, collaborating with cross-functional teams to innovate user experiences, implement AI features, and mentor junior engineers while ensuring high-quality code.
This role involves designing and implementing scalable deployment solutions, enhancing developer toolchain integrations, maintaining CI/CD pipelines, and collaborating with engineering teams to improve productivity. The Senior Software Engineer will own their infrastructure and help evolve technical standards within the Infrastructure Engineering team at Clear Street.
As a Senior Software Engineer, you'll lead product development, collaborating with design and sales teams to create consumer-friendly applications. You will own projects from conception to launch, focusing on user experience and data-driven decisions.
As a Senior Software Engineer at Nuveaux, you will develop backend features, optimize data delivery, improve database performance, and enhance infrastructure. The role requires production-level experience in Go and knowledge of distributed systems, with an emphasis on collaboration and quality in software development.
Featured Jobs
As a Staff Software Engineer at EliseAI, you'll contribute to the core software platform, develop features, propose architecture improvements, and drive engineering best practices. Collaboration and innovation are key as you work in a fast-paced environment focused on automating leasing processes and improving operational efficiencies.
The role involves building and operating query execution engines, enhancing query language features, and developing fault-tolerant, scalable solutions in a multi-tenant environment. Responsibilities include querying parsing, planning, and optimization using C++ and Go, and having an impact on the service while growing within the company.
As a Principal Engineer on the Orders Ecosystem Platform team, you will lead the design and architecture of large-scale distributed systems that support order management services. You will mentor other engineers, influence the platform's technical direction, deliver scalable and resilient solutions, and collaborate with cross-functional teams to improve system performance and reliability.
As a Staff Software Engineer at Datadog, you will lead high-impact projects focused on improving PostgreSQL performance and functionality, develop extensions, contribute to core Postgres changes, and enhance customers' database experiences through automated recommendations and observability features.
As a Staff Software Engineer at Huntress, you will lead the design and development of features for the Huntress Security Platform while managing technical aspects of feature development. Responsibilities include overseeing architecture, mentoring junior engineers, and implementing high-quality software solutions in a fast-paced environment.
As a Software Engineer at Databento, you will design, develop, and maintain scalable APIs and backend services primarily with Python and FastAPI. You will collaborate with product designers and frontend engineers to implement new features and manage database migrations. The role also involves ensuring application stability, implementing monitoring, and maintaining CI/CD best practices.
The Full Stack Engineer will design, develop, and maintain scalable APIs and backend services, work with frontend engineers to build web application features, manage database schema changes, and ensure smooth feature rollouts. The role requires strong communication skills for collaboration in a remote setting.
As a Senior Software Developer at A·Team, you will engage in impactful missions, building software from the ground up in small teams. You’ll be invited to choose projects that align with your interests and guide clients through the strategic execution of their software visions. The role emphasizes collaboration with top-tier builders and offers the flexibility of independent work.
The Senior Software Engineer will contribute across the tech stack, focusing on backend and frontend development, code reviews, troubleshooting, performance optimization, and technical leadership. Collaboration with engineering, product, and design teams is necessary to create new features and improve processes.
The Software Engineer, Security role involves working with various teams to enhance cloud security. The candidate will design and automate fault-tolerant security solutions, guide teams on security practices, and contribute to improving the company's security posture. Responsibilities include managing security risks, participating in incident response, and influencing product development based on security needs.
The Fullstack Software Engineer will develop and maintain Pave's compensation platform using modern web technologies, collaborate with cross-functional teams, and navigate ambiguities in product development to enhance customer experience and product features.
The Backend Software Engineer will develop and maintain a compensation platform using modern web technologies. Responsibilities include collaborating with cross-functional teams, ensuring strong architectural vision, and navigating system design challenges. The role emphasizes product-centric engineering to enhance the compensation strategy lifecycle for customers.
The API Management Technical Lead will develop and enhance Boomi's Cloud API Management services, guiding Agile teams through the software development lifecycle. Responsibilities include mentoring engineers, collaborating with product management, resolving customer issues, and making technology decisions for scalable web applications and API services.
As a Senior Backend Engineer, you will own mission-critical applications, collaborating with a team to build services for RocketReach’s integrations platform, Enterprise API, and AI automation. You will design and develop new features and iterate on existing functionalities to enhance customer satisfaction and drive growth.
Join our innovative Portfolio Accounting team as a Staff Software Engineer, where you'll build a scalable accounting engine while collaborating closely on design and engineering. You'll impact the tech stack with AWS services, mentor teams, and contribute to high-quality applications. This role requires strong software engineering skills along with a passion for finance and a commitment to software development best practices.
Join the Disaster Recovery team at Cockroach Labs as a Backend Software Engineer, focusing on enhancing the backup and restore features of CockroachDB. You will develop in Go, collaborate with engineers and product managers, and contribute to the growth of this cloud-native SQL database, ensuring scalability and consistency.
At Saturn Technologies, we are looking for a Senior Software Engineer, Full Stack to join our team. Responsibilities include building complex applications, collaborating with cross-functional teams, leading development of user-facing features, and guiding app architecture. The ideal candidate should have strong backend development experience, knowledge of modern web app best practices, leadership skills, and experience with relational databases like Postgres and NoSQL databases.
Top Companies in NYC, NY Hiring Software Engineers
See AllPopular Job Searches
All Software Engineer Jobs in NYC
.NET Developer Jobs in NYC
Android Developer Jobs in NYC
C# Jobs in NYC
C++ Jobs in NYC
DevOps Jobs in NYC
Engineering Manager Jobs in NYC
Front End Developer Jobs in NYC
Golang Jobs in NYC
Hardware Engineer Jobs in NYC
iOS Developer Jobs in NYC
Java Developer Jobs in NYC
Javascript Jobs in NYC
Linux Jobs in NYC
Perl Jobs in NYC
PHP Developer Jobs in NYC
Python Jobs in NYC
QA Jobs in NYC
Ruby Jobs in NYC
Sales Engineer Jobs in NYC
Salesforce Developer Jobs in NYC
Scala Jobs in NYC
Artificial Intelligence Jobs in NYC
Artificial Intelligence Engineer Jobs in NYC
AWS Engineer Jobs in NYC
Backend Engineer Jobs in NYC
DevOps Engineer Jobs in NYC
Director of Engineering Jobs in NYC
Engineering Jobs in NYC
Full Stack Engineer Jobs in NYC
Infrastructure Engineer Jobs in NYC
Lead Software Engineer Jobs in NYC
Network Engineer Jobs in NYC
Platform Engineer Jobs in NYC
Principal Architect Jobs in NYC
Principal Engineer Jobs in NYC
Principal Software Engineer Jobs in NYC
Quality Assurance Automation Engineer Jobs in NYC
Reliability Engineer Jobs in NYC
Senior Backend Engineer Jobs in NYC
Senior Cloud Engineer Jobs in NYC
Senior Full-Stack Engineer Jobs in NYC
Senior Platform Engineer Jobs in NYC
Senior Python Engineer Jobs in NYC
Senior Site Reliability Engineer Jobs in NYC
Solutions Architect Jobs in NYC
Solutions Engineer Jobs in NYC
Staff Engineer Jobs in NYC
Staff Software Engineer Jobs in NYC
Systems Engineer Jobs in NYC
Vice President of Engineering Jobs in NYC
All Filters
No Results
No Results